According to the Bank’s website, the TA will support selected DMCs to enhance their recovery readiness and resilience to disasters triggered by natural hazards. Increasing disaster risk and frequency in Asia and the Pacific is having a detrimental impact on growth and development outcomes. DMCs require assistance to improve their ability to lead an effective disaster recovery process, given the increasingly complex and often compounding contexts, including the widening gender disparities, in disasters.
According to the Technical Assistance Report, the Risk Categories are:
Environment: Not Applicable
Involuntary Resettlement: Not Applicable
Indigenous Peoples: Not Applicable
The TA financing amount is $2,000,000, which will be financed on a grant basis by the Japan Fund for Prosperous and Resilient Asia and the Pacific (JFPR) and administered by ADB.

ACCOUNTABILITY MECHANISM OF ADB
The Accountability Mechanism is an independent complaint mechanism and fact-finding body for people who believe they are likely to be, or have been, adversely affected by an Asian Development Bank-financed project. If you submit a complaint to the Accountability Mechanism, they may investigate to assess whether the Asian Development Bank is following its own policies and procedures for preventing harm to people or the environment.
